Brad Hornung Trophy
The Brad Hornung Trophy is a trophy of the Western Hockey League . The award has been given annually since the end of the 1966/67 season to the fairest athletic player in the WHL. The winner has also participated in the election for CHL Sportsman of the Year since 1990 .
The trophy is named after Brad Hornung , a Regina Pats player who has been paralyzed since a league game on March 1, 1987. Therefore, the trophy has only had its name since 1987. Previously, the award was called the CMJHL Most Gentlemanly Player Award (1966–1967), WCHL Most Gentlemanly Player Award (1967–1978) and WHL Most Gentlemanly Player Award (1978–1987).
